Title :
Dual-mode stripline resonator array for fast error compensated moisture mapping of paper web

Abstract :
A mechanically simple and therefore inexpensive sensor array for fast mapping of the water content of wet paper has been developed. The sensors are UHF stripline resonators, which have two degenerate resonance modes, even and odd. The difference of these two frequencies can be used to achieve a high accuracy, because the resonance frequency of the odd mode is not affected by moisture changes in the wet paper, and can therefore be used for error compensation. Because of the electronic scanning, the measurement is very fast and it makes almost real-time water content profiling possible.<>
